技术文摘
在JavaScript中创建if语句检查变量是否等于某个单词的方法
在JavaScript中创建if语句检查变量是否等于某个单词是编程中常见的操作。掌握这个方法,能让开发者在处理各种逻辑判断时更加得心应手。
我们要明确if语句的基本语法结构。在JavaScript里,if语句用于基于某个条件来决定是否执行特定的代码块。它的基本形式如下:
if (条件) {
// 当条件为真时执行的代码
}
现在我们来探讨如何检查变量是否等于某个单词。假设我们有一个变量,用来存储用户输入的信息,我们想要判断这个变量的值是否等于特定的单词。例如:
let userInput = "hello";
let targetWord = "hello";
if (userInput === targetWord) {
console.log("变量的值等于目标单词");
}
在这段代码中,我们使用了严格相等运算符 ===。这是非常关键的一点,严格相等运算符不仅会比较两个值是否相等,还会检查它们的数据类型是否相同。如果使用普通的相等运算符 ==,可能会出现一些意外的结果,因为它在某些情况下会进行类型转换。
除了简单的直接比较,还可能遇到需要忽略大小写进行比较的情况。比如用户输入的单词大小写不固定,但我们只关心内容是否一致。这时可以使用字符串的 toLowerCase() 或 toUpperCase() 方法。示例如下:
let userInput2 = "Hello";
let targetWord2 = "hello";
if (userInput2.toLowerCase() === targetWord2.toLowerCase()) {
console.log("忽略大小写后,变量的值等于目标单词");
}
在实际项目中,这种检查变量是否等于某个单词的操作经常用于表单验证、用户权限判断等场景。例如,在一个登录系统中,我们可以检查用户输入的用户名是否与预先设定的管理员用户名相等,以此来判断用户是否具有管理员权限。
在JavaScript中通过if语句检查变量是否等于某个单词并不复杂,关键在于正确使用比较运算符以及根据实际需求处理数据类型和大小写等问题。熟练掌握这一技巧,能为我们的编程工作带来更多便利,提升代码的逻辑性和可靠性。
TAGS: JavaScript_if语句 变量检查 变量等于单词 创建if语句
- Vue3 对比 Vue2:构建工具链更快的差异体现
- Vue3 较 Vue2 的进步:更灵活自定义指令
- Vue3 与 Vue2 区别:代码结构更清晰
- Uniapp 中实时聊天功能的实现方法
- Vue3 对比 Vue2:前端工程化的新优势
- Vue3 对比 Vue2:API 更简洁
- UniApp 扫码与二维码识别实现方法
- Vue3 与 Vue2 的区别:更丰富的生命周期钩子函数
- Vue3 对比 Vue2:条件渲染能力的显著提升
- Vue3 对比 Vue2:动态组件创建更便捷之处
- Vue3 对比 Vue2 的变化:网络请求库整合更强大
- Vue3 较 Vue2 的改进:带来更优开发体验
- Vue3 较 Vue2 的进步:更先进的路由管理器
- Vue3 对比 Vue2:打包大小更轻量
- Vue3 对比 Vue2:更优的代码重用性表现